Gucci Disney Collaboration Overview
The Gucci Disney collaboration is a luxury fashion partnership between Kering-owned Gucci and The Walt Disney Company. The partnership brings Disney intellectual property into Gucci's apparel, accessories, and footwear lines. It targets high-income consumers and fans of Disney franchises. The collaboration aligns with Gucci's strategy to expand its cultural relevance through entertainment IP. The collaboration draws on Disney's extensive portfolio of characters, films, and theme park experiences. Gucci integrates Disney motifs into its signature designs, including logos, prints, and accessories. The partnership expands Gucci's reach into family and pop culture audiences. Disney benefits from the association with a top luxury fashion house. The collaboration is part of a broader trend of luxury brands partnering with entertainment franchises to create limited-edition collections.
Products and Collections
The Gucci Disney collection includes apparel, bags, shoes, and accessories featuring Disney characters and themes. Key items include jackets, dresses, and knitwear with Disney prints and embroidery. Key Product Categories
Apparel pieces include outerwear, knitwear, and dresses with Disney-themed graphics. Accessories range from bags and belts to scarves and hats. Footwear includes sneakers and dress shoes with Disney-inspired details. The collection also features limited-edition items and special releases tied to specific Disney properties or events.
